Can it be cured???
There are many different medications people can take for this disorder, in some cases all of the symptoms may go away with the right medications but it wont go completely away you still have to continue taking the medications. With the medications there are many symptoms of using the medications. There is also therapy that people can get that helps with the symptoms also and that may get rid of them all together. But if you have had schizophrenia you are more susceptible to getting it again. It is very hard to control because many people forget to take their medications, many people who would rather self medicate, some people think that it is gone and they stop taking their medications. What is the cause of Schizophrenia?
Researchers have agreed that schizophrenia is caused by a mixture of the persons genetics and the person's environmental settings. If schizophrenia runs in your family you may have a chance of getting it yourself. Although you cant do anything to change your genetics you can change some things in your life as a teenager; like not using street drugs, moderating amounts of alcohol, develop social skills as much as possible, avoid social isolation, keep social connections with adults, learn to look at the world positively, find ways to deal with stress and anxiety in a good way. Get professional help if needed.
